Housewife Katalin Munk has her world torn apart when her lecturer husband János arrives home to tell her that he’s leaving her for a younger student of his. Katalin falls into a state of shock and wanders about the streets of Budapest in just her dressing gown carrying a pair of scissors. After a series of misadventures, Katalin eventually ends up in Turkey, where suddenly Katalin is awakened and decides to start a new life after meeting local man Halil. Meanwhile her son Zoli tries to hunt Katalin down.

Ferenc Török (born Budapest, 23 April 1971) is a Hungarian film director. He has received Béla Balázs Award, a state recognition for outstanding achievement in filmmaking. Török is a member of the European Film Academy. In 1995, he was admitted to the Academy of Drama and Film in Budapest. His final graduation project film, Moscow Square, won the "Best First Film" award at the Hungarian Film Festival in 2000.
